Review by Kevin Sorensen 🇩🇰
10.04.1987 Lanternen, Kolding (bygone bar). This one the bar had on their shelf. After they found out I liked rum they started to stick a few. Notes Medium dark to very dark in colour. Nose Fresh, light, wood, light caramel, fruits. Palate Light, wood, faint roasted, rough, berries, faint caramel, raisin. Finish Short to medium, wood, dried fruit, faint chocolate. 3.5 stars of 5 which should amount to 7.0 today. Extra note. Tried this one in a Rum'n'Coke and it also did pretty well with a lemon slice and fresh mint leaves.
